Abstract
A suspension of a coating material having hydrogen bonds and pre-determined physical and chemical characteristics in a predominantly solid state in a polar solvent that is capable of breaking the hydrogen bonds and providing the material in a liquid form and use of the suspension to provide substantially uniform conformal layer of material onto a workpiece by applying the suspension to a workpiece and then evaporating the polar organic solvent so that the coating material is provided in its predominantly solid state having substantially the predetermined physicall and chemical characteristics.
